Overnight Digest: Stocks to watch on November 30

The stocks most likely to witness significant movement on the bourses on November 30 are JSW Steel, HUDCO, Indian Energy Exchange, IVP and HUL.

JSW Steel: The board approved the Scheme of Amalgamation of Dolvi Minerals and Metals Private Limited (DMMPL), Dolvi Coke Projects Limited (DCPL), JSW Steel Processing Centres Limited (JSPCL) and JSW Salav with JSW Steel. The stock will be monitored on Friday.

Housing and Urban Development Corporation (HUDCO): The company raised funds of Rs. 2,050 crore through issue of government of India fully-serviced, unsecured taxable bond series – II 2018. The proceeds from the same were utilized for lending to Building Materials and Technology Promotion Council (BMTPC). The stock is likely to witness some movement in Friday’s trading session.

IVP: CRISIL has downgraded the credit rating of long-term bank facilities from ‘CRISIL BBB/Stable’ to ‘CRISIL BBB-/Stable’. CRISIL also downgraded the credit rating of short-term bank facilities from ‘CRISIL A3+’ to ‘CRISIL A3’. The share will be monitored during Friday’s trading session.

Indian Energy Exchange: IEX trades 3.88 lakh RECs during the trading session on November 28. The trading session saw a decline of 79 per cent on a YoY basis and 9 per cent on MoM basis. The stock will be monitored on Friday.

Hindustan Unilever (HUL): The company is leading in the race for acquiring GSK’s Horlicks business. The stock was up 2 per cent at the end of Thursday’s trading session. It will be watched on Friday.
